`Shell Duck`

Visited LCyD at 13.00hrs today (Friday) another (fowl) foul day with a `hide temp of only 6c`
A small number of Wigeon still present, a pair of male Goosander and a delightful pair of Shell Duck, one was a female as seen on the water but a pair took flight and unable to sex the second bird.
